NEET-PG result declared in record 10 days. Here's how to check score
The NEET-PG exam was held on May 12.

NEET PG 2022 was held on May 21 at 849 centres.
A total of 1,82,318 candidates had taken the test.
Meanwhile, Health Minister Mansukh Mandaviya congratulated all the students who qualified the exam. The minister also lauded the NBEMS for announcing the results in record 10 days.
